STORE Awards

Pizza Making
Champions

Finalists of the Pizza Making Competition Trials compete for the title of the Australia & New Zealand Pizza Making Champion. The winners are the team that achieves the fastest pizza making time whilst observing all rules of pizza making with weight penalties applied.

PREVIOUS WINNERS:

  • 2019 - Earlville

  • 2020 - Earlville

  • 2021 - Waurn Ponds

  • 2022 - Earlville

  • 2023 - Manunda

  • 2024 - Mildura

  • 2025 - Cancelled

  • 2026 - Aberfoyle

PRIZE:

  • Team Trophy

  • 4 x Individual Medals, Aprons & Hats

Tom S Monaghan
Nobody delivers better

This award is named in honour of the founder of Domino’s and recognises a crucial element of our business success – service. Awarded to the store with the best delivery service %, GPS % and Singles %. The store must average a minimum of 50 deliveries per week. Store must have a minimum of 90% assigned deliveries for the award period.

PREVIOUS WINNERS:

  • 2018 - Northam

  • 2019 - Northam

  • 2020 - Northam

  • 2021 - Sorell

  • 2022 - Northam

  • 2023 - Thames

  • 2024 - Rochedale

  • 2025 - Charlestown

PRIZE:

  • Trophy
